PA Career Info: Training Programs, Tasks And Salary

Like the term indicates, physician assistant is generally somebody that helps out doctors in their day to day job. Typically, they have their own licenses and certifications and perform far more duties than medical assistants. But nevertheless, physician assistants are not registered as medical doctors. Under normal circumstances, physician assistants really do not function under direct supervision of a doctor.

There are plenty of assignments that physician's assistants are usually meant to carry out. For instance, these people are trained to assess different patients and then provide a specific description of their conditions. Moreover, any training program for a physician's assistant includes equipping the person with the important abilities with which to detect medical conditions as well as prescribe meds with the consent of their specific doctor supervisors. In addition to that they go through comprehensive training in all of the important techniques such as looking after injuries and wounds and also immunization.

Generally, in order to be a physician assistant, you will need to finish and pass an authorized training program. The AAPA ( American Academy of Physician Assistants ) is the institution responsible for providing all the criteria in relation to requirements as well as actual eligibility.

The physician assistant salary is dependent upon the place where the individual is working, his or her type of area of expertise and also working experience. For example, someone in internal medicine makes somewhere between $73,000 and $90,000 per annum. A person that has a working experience of a lot less than one year makes approximately $77,000. After around five to nine years of practical experience, this goes up to to $91,000 and might even reach up to $100,000 per year with over 15 years' practical experience. Assuming the present development would be the basis, the region of Houston, Texas is without a doubt the place that would offer very high wages for physician assistants. The possible income in Houston, Texas is normally around $71,000 and $92,000. The state of New York is second with an average annual earnings of around $70,000 and $90,000.
